There are nine wires which need to be

attached to a circuit board. A robotic device will attach the wires. The wires can be attached in any order, and the production manager wishes to determine which order would be fastest for the robot to use. Use the multiplication rule of counting to determine the number of possible sequences of assembly that must be tested. (Hint:There are nine choices for the first wire, eight for the second wire, seven for the third wire, etc.)
